Jörg Bettendorf
Jörg Bettendorf (* 1946 ) is a German notary .
Career
Bettendorf has been working as a notary since 1983, initially in Krefeld and since 2005 in Hilden .
Beyond his immediate professional sphere of activity, he campaigned for the interests of his profession. In 1997 he became a member of the board of directors of the Rhineland Chamber of Notaries and served as its vice-president from 2001 to April 2009.
Since it was founded in 1981, he has long been a member of the IT working group of the Rhineland Chamber of Notaries and also acted as chairman of the IT committee of the Federal Chamber of Notaries . In these offices he was instrumental in promoting the use of information technology in the notary's office.
He played a key role in founding Notarnet GmbH in 2000, which, with the notary network, provides notaries throughout Germany with a secure network for electronic communication. In 2005, IT recommendations for notaries and notary auditors were drawn up under his leadership. He also played a key role in the introduction of electronic signatures and a certification body for digital signatures at the Federal Chamber of Notaries.
Honors
- 1993: Cross of Merit on Ribbon of the Federal Republic of Germany
- September 23, 2009: Cross of Merit 1st Class of the Federal Republic of Germany
- in recognition of the special merits of the honoree in the preventive administration of justice and the notarial status
Works
- Electronic right-hand traffic. - Neuwied: Luchterhand, 2000
- IT and the Internet in notarial practice. - Cologne: Heymann, 2002
